Ross brings together many discourses from dance history, pedagogical theory, women's history, feminist theory, American history, and the history of the body in intelligent, exciting, and illuminating ways and adds a new chapter to each of them. She shows how H'Doubler, like Isadora Duncan and other modern dancers, helped to raise dance in the eyes of the middle class from its despised status as lower-class entertainment and "dangerous" social interaction to a serious enterprise. Taking a nuanced critical approach to the history of women's bodies and their representations, "Moving Lessons" fills a very large gap in the history of dance education.
